Games expose engineering weakness quickly. You feel bad architecture as frame drops, jitter, and player confusion.
Current stack
- SwiftUI for UI and shell experience
- SpriteKit for gameplay runtime
- WidgetKit for lightweight companion surfaces
Lessons so far
- Keep gameplay loops testable in isolation
- Measure performance early on lower-power devices
- Separate content tuning from engine code paths
Why this project matters to me
It exercises a different part of engineering discipline: balancing feel, performance, and maintainability.
